What Are the Key Benefits of Choosing a Standby Power Generator?

The key benefits of choosing a standby power generator include reliability, convenience, and increased property value.

  • Reliability: Standby generators automatically kick in during a power outage, ensuring that essential appliances and systems remain powered without interruption. This reliability is crucial for homes in areas prone to frequent blackouts or severe weather conditions.
  • Convenience: Unlike portable generators, standby generators are permanently installed and require no manual setup during an outage. They operate seamlessly, allowing homeowners to continue their daily activities without disruption, as lighting, heating, and refrigeration stay functional.
  • Increased Property Value: Installing a standby generator can enhance the overall value of a home, making it more attractive to potential buyers. Many homebuyers appreciate the security of knowing they will have power during emergencies, which can be a significant selling point.
  • Enhanced Safety: Standby generators provide power to safety systems like security alarms and sump pumps, which can prevent flooding and protect property during outages. This added layer of safety can give homeowners peace of mind, knowing that their home is secure even when the power goes out.
  • Fuel Efficiency: Many standby generators are designed to operate on natural gas or propane, making them more fuel-efficient than traditional gas-powered generators. This efficiency not only reduces fuel costs but also minimizes emissions, contributing to a more environmentally friendly operation.

Power Output: The generator’s power output is crucial as it determines how many appliances and systems can be powered simultaneously during an outage. You should calculate your total wattage needs to ensure the generator can handle your essential loads without overloading.

Automatic Transfer Switch (ATS): An ATS allows the generator to automatically switch on and off during power outages, ensuring seamless operation without the need for manual intervention. This feature is particularly useful for maintaining power to critical systems like sump pumps and medical equipment during emergencies.

Fuel Type: The type of fuel the generator uses—such as natural gas, propane, or diesel—affects its efficiency, availability, and operational costs. Choosing a fuel type that is easily accessible in your area can help ensure you can keep the generator running when necessary.

Noise Level: Generators can be noisy, so looking for one with a low decibel rating can help minimize disturbances, especially in residential areas. A quieter generator can also be more neighbor-friendly, making it suitable for urban environments.

Run Time: The run time indicates how long the generator can operate on a full tank of fuel, which is essential for planning how long you can rely on it during extended outages. A longer run time means less frequent refueling, providing more convenience and reliability during emergencies.

Durability and Build Quality: A well-built generator can withstand various weather conditions and usage demands, ensuring it remains operational when you need it most. Look for models constructed from high-quality materials that offer corrosion resistance and weatherproofing features.

Maintenance Requirements: Understanding the maintenance needs, such as oil changes and filter replacements, can help you choose a generator that is easy to care for and has a longer life span. Regular maintenance is key to ensuring reliability, so consider how easy it is to access components for servicing.

Smart Features: Many modern generators come with smart technology that allows remote monitoring and control through a smartphone app, enhancing convenience and usability. These features can provide alerts for maintenance needs and operational status, making it easier to manage your power supply.

What Factors Influence the Overall Cost of Standby Power Generators?

  • Generator Size: The capacity and size of the generator determine its price, as larger generators capable of producing more power typically cost more due to the complexity of their design and construction.
  • Type of Fuel: Standby generators can run on various fuels such as natural gas, propane, or diesel, with costs varying significantly; for instance, diesel generators might be more expensive due to fuel prices and maintenance needs.
  • Installation Costs: The complexity of the installation process can greatly affect overall costs, as factors like location, electrical work, and necessary permits can add to the final price.
  • Brand and Quality: Reputable brands often have higher prices due to their reliability, warranty options, and customer support, while lesser-known brands might offer lower initial costs but could incur higher long-term maintenance expenses.
  • Features and Technology: Advanced features such as automatic transfer switches, remote monitoring, and smart technology can increase costs, but they also enhance convenience and efficiency.
  • Maintenance and Service Plans: The availability and cost of maintenance agreements influence the long-term investment, with comprehensive service plans often adding to the upfront cost but potentially saving money on repairs in the future.
  • Local Regulations: Compliance with local building codes and regulations can impact costs; certain areas may require specific permits or emission controls that can add to the overall expense.

What Maintenance Practices Are Required for Standby Power Generators?

Regular maintenance practices are essential for ensuring the reliability and longevity of standby power generators.

  • Routine Inspections: Regular inspections should be conducted to check for any visible signs of wear or damage. This includes examining the generator’s housing, connections, and fuel lines to prevent potential failures.
  • Oil and Filter Changes: Changing the oil and oil filter is crucial to keep the engine lubricated and functioning properly. This should typically be done every 100 to 150 hours of operation or at least once a year, depending on usage.
  • Battery Maintenance: Ensuring that the generator’s battery is in good condition is vital for reliable starting. This involves checking the battery’s charge level, cleaning any corrosion from terminals, and replacing the battery if it shows signs of wear.
  • Cooling System Checks: The cooling system must be regularly checked to ensure that it is functioning properly, which includes inspecting coolant levels and hoses for leaks. Overheating can lead to serious engine damage, so maintaining optimal cooling is essential.
  • Fuel System Maintenance: Regularly inspect the fuel system for leaks and ensure that filters are clean. Stale fuel can cause performance issues, so it is important to replace fuel and treat it with a stabilizer if the generator is not used frequently.
  • Exercise Runs: Performing monthly exercise runs helps to keep the generator in good working condition. This involves running the generator under load for about 30 minutes to ensure all components function properly and to prevent mechanical issues.
  • Software Updates: If the generator is equipped with a digital control panel, it’s important to periodically check for firmware updates. Keeping the software up to date can enhance performance and improve reliability.

What Considerations Should You Keep in Mind Before Buying a Standby Power Generator?

Before purchasing a standby power generator, several key considerations should be evaluated to ensure you select the best option for your needs.

  • Power Output: Assessing the wattage needed to power essential appliances during an outage is crucial. This includes determining the starting and running watts of devices like refrigerators, air conditioners, and heating systems to ensure the generator can handle the load.
  • Fuel Type: Standby generators can run on various fuels including natural gas, propane, or diesel. Each fuel type has its advantages and disadvantages, such as availability, cost, and storage requirements, which should be considered based on your location and usage patterns.
  • Installations and Maintenance: The installation process can be complex and may require professional assistance to ensure compliance with local codes. Additionally, understanding the maintenance needs, such as oil changes and battery checks, is essential for the longevity and reliability of the generator.
  • Transfer Switch: A transfer switch is necessary for safely connecting the generator to your home’s electrical system. Ensure that the generator you choose is compatible with the transfer switch type, whether it’s manual or automatic, to provide seamless power transition during outages.
  • Noise Level: Generators can produce significant noise, which might be an issue in residential areas. Reviewing the decibel rating of the generator can help you choose a quieter model that won’t disturb you or your neighbors during operation.
  • Warranty and Support: Investigate the warranty offered by the manufacturer and the availability of customer support. A solid warranty can provide peace of mind, while good customer support can assist you in troubleshooting and maintaining the generator effectively.
  • Budget: Establishing a budget is essential as standby generators can vary greatly in price. Consider not only the initial purchase cost but also installation, fuel, and maintenance expenses to get a complete picture of your investment.
